New Income Tax Bill 2025

August 15 , 2025 15 hrs 0 min 65 0
  • Parliament passed the Income Tax (No. 2) Bill, 2025 to replace the Income Tax Act 1961 after sixty years.
  • The new law aims to modernise tax administration without changing current tax rates.
  • It simplifies the terminology by introducing the unified term tax year instead of assessment year and previous year.
  • The bill has 536 sections and 16 schedules.
  • The number of chapters has been brought down to 23 from 47 and the number of Sections to 536 from 819.
  • It allows individuals to claim tax deducted at source (TDS) refunds even if returns are filed late without penalty.
  • It also broadens the powers of income tax officials, allowing them to forcibly break into personal emails and social media accounts of assesses during search operations.
